The bug is caused not by an automake upgrade, but by this commit: http://sources.gentoo.org/cgi-bin/viewvc.cgi/gentoo-x86/eclass/autotools.eclass?r1=1.116&r2=1.117 Which was added to fix Bug #397697. Not being an autotools guy, I am not certain if this fix wasn't 100%, or if fwbuilder's build system is broken in a subtle way and this change exposes another upstream bug. Those who really need fwbuilder, a temporary fix is to revert BOTH rev 1.117 and 1.116 on /usr/portage/eclass/autotools.eclass, then re-run fwbuilder until further advice is provided from toolchain on a more appropriate fix.
